What are the three standards of professionalism?
Professionalism is a set of characteristics that displays your ability to be a hardworking, dependable and respectful individual in formal settings.
What are 3-5 samples of professionalism?
Examples of professional traits include competence, integrity, respectfulness, effective communication, and commitment, among others.
What are the three stages of professionalism?
After looking at these results, I think professionalism can be broken down into three sections: behavior, communication, and presentation. In this blog, I want to dive into each of the sections and share with you some key areas to help you excel as a professional in your workplace.
What are the three most important aspects of professionalism?
Jason Burns authored the blog post “Why Professionalism Matters More Than Performance,” in which he states, “Professionalism, in any industry, simply means that you treat others with respect, value people's time, keep your commitments, and act with integrity” [3].
